Unhappy i cant get the check engine light to turn off!!! help

I have a 3.0 premium that has the check engine light on. its been close to a year now and its stilllll on. i went to a mechanic and paid for a engine dyegnostic. he told me it was the EGR valve, so i went and bought a new one. i had it installed and the engine light was still on. i went and got it checked again and was told it was the same thing. i had the engine cleaned out cause someone told me that might be the problem. i tought it was fixed cause the light finally went off. but after close to 60 miles the light turned back on. i have no clue wat it is so i guess i gave up and learned to live with it. i've spend close to 400 bucks trying to get rid of that dam light and cant do it. hopefully someone can help me cause that orange light is an eye sore!!

If you've been driving with a clogged EGR for the last year, then you'll have to do more than just buy a new EGR. Your Manifold probably needs to be taken off and totally cleaned out, as well as a seafoam treatment. While your at it go ahead and change your plugs. Also, Autozone will check the CEL for free but usually wont clear/erase the CEL (something about policy).
